I think this is indeed one of the highlights of my tours and I have a special fond for this place...I am not sure because I have never been there but I always says that this is a very small version of the Florida's everglades, but the coolest things is that we are in Rio de Janeiro.
Marapendi is a complex of various lagoons in the west side of Rio, it has about 7 islands, some islands people live, other islands are protected reserve areas and one island is a big country club where people can have a lot of pleasant activities such as practicing sports and simply to have a good time with friends and family.
For the moment and I hope it takes a long time, Marapendi is not even writen in any travel book, so it is a very local and down to earth place. The pace of life is slow and calm and you will be thinking that it is hard to believe that in a city which has the World's famous Copacabana you can find this little peace of paradise that Marapendi shows you all the time you go there!

VERY IMPORTANT NOTE: We take people to the wetlands, but we cannot include the boatmen payment, so bear in mind that we all have to give 15 reais (each person), which is about 7 american dollars, for the trip that takes about 40 minutes to one hour.
A good suggestion is stopping in a local bar called Cicero for some delicious local snacks (specially schrimps) in one of the islands.
